Norway - Construction FDI Income Payments
At -$20.53 Million in 2018, the country was number 22 among other countries in Construction FDI Income Payments. Norway is overtaken by Iceland, which was ranked number 21 with -$14.11 Million and is followed by Netherlands at -$37.77 Million. Australia topped the ranking with $1,290.81 Million in 2018, an increase of 7.3% versus 2017. Poland, Germany and Czech Republic resp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Lithuania recorded the best 5 years average growth at +121.5% per year, while Estonia was the worst growing country at -21.7% per year.
